Why These Are the Top Kitchen Remodeling Contractors in Sturdivant

** The kitchen remodeling market for residents of Sturdivant, Missouri, is characterized by its reliance on regional contractors from larger neighboring hubs like Sikeston, Cape Girardeau, and Dexter. Due to the rural nature of the area, there is no localized competition within Sturdivant itself. Homeowners must look to these surrounding cities for professional services. The overall quality of available contractors is quite good, with several long-standing, family-owned businesses operating in the region. These companies have built their reputations on serving rural communities and small towns across Southeastern Missouri. The competition level is moderate among these regional players, which helps maintain fair pricing and a focus on customer service. Typical pricing for a full kitchen remodel in this market can range significantly based on scope and material choices. Homeowners can expect: * **Budget-Friendly Updates** (refacing, new countertops, paint): $10,000 - $25,000 * **Mid-Range Full Remodel** (new cabinets, mid-tier quartz, appliance package, new flooring): $25,000 - $50,000 * **High-End Custom Renovation** (custom cabinetry, high-end stone, layout changes, premium appliances): $50,000+ It is crucial for Sturdivant homeowners to factor in potential travel fees for contractors based further away, though many include service to the region in their standard pricing. Verifying licensing and insurance is always recommended before committing to any project.

1What is a realistic budget range for a full kitchen remodel in Sturdivant, Missouri?

For a full remodel in our area, including new cabinets, countertops, flooring, and appliances, homeowners should budget between $25,000 and $50,000, with high-end projects exceeding that. Costs are influenced by material choices and the scale of layout changes, but regional pricing in Southeast Missouri is generally more moderate than national averages. Always factor in a contingency of 10-20% for unexpected issues common in older Sturdivant homes, like updating electrical or plumbing.

2How does the Missouri climate, with its humid summers and cold winters, affect my kitchen remodel choices?

Sturdivant's humidity demands careful material selection to prevent warping; opt for stable cabinet materials like plywood boxes and consider moisture-resistant flooring such as luxury vinyl plank. Proper ventilation is critical to manage summer humidity and cooking moisture, so investing in a high-quality range hood vented to the exterior is a must. Additionally, ensuring your new kitchen is well-insulated helps with energy efficiency against our variable seasonal temperatures.

4What's the best time of year to start a kitchen remodel in Southeast Missouri? **Question:** What's the best time of year to start a kitchen remodel in Southeast Missouri?

Late spring and early fall are ideal, avoiding the peak humidity of summer which can affect drying times for drywall and paint, and the deep winter freeze which can complicate material deliveries. Planning your project timeline around local farming seasons can also be beneficial, as contractor availability may be greater outside of major regional harvest periods. Scheduling well in advance is key, as reliable local crews are often booked months ahead.
